Subject: Re: [PATCH 14/26] dtt200u: don't do DMA on stack
On Fri, 7 Oct 2016 14:24:24 -0300
Mauro Carvalho Chehab <mchehab@...pensource.com> wrote:
> From: Mauro Carvalho Chehab <mchehab@....samsung.com>
>
> The USB control messages require DMA to work. We cannot pass
> a stack-allocated buffer, as it is not warranted that the
> stack would be into a DMA enabled area.
>
> Signed-off-by: Mauro Carvalho Chehab <mchehab@....samsung.com>
> Signed-off-by: Mauro Carvalho Chehab <mchehab@...pensource.com>
> ---
> drivers/media/usb/dvb-usb/dtt200u.c | 73
> +++++++++++++++++++++++++------------ 1 file changed, 49
> insertions(+), 24 deletions(-)
